It is our great pleasure to share with you that the Open Graph Benchmark (OGB) is hosting a large-scale graph machine learning challenge (OGB-LSC) at KDD Cup 2021 (from Mar. 15th to Jun. 8th, 2021).

OGB-LSC is a collection of three graph datasets—PCQM4M-LSC, WikiKG90M-LSC, and MAG240M-LSC—that are orders of magnitude larger than existing ones. The three datasets correspond to link prediction, graph regression, and node classification tasks, respectively. The goal of OGB-LSC is to empower the community to discover innovative solutions for large-scale graph ML. More details about the challenge can be found at https://ogb.stanford.edu/kddcup2021.

The competition will be from March 15th, 2021 until June 8th, 2021 and the winners will be notified by mid-June 2021. The winners will be honored at the KDD 2021 opening ceremony and will present their solutions at the KDD Cup workshop during the conference.
